Royal Jordanian buys one new 'Falcon' plane
Jordan, Business, 1/14/2002
The Jordanian Royal airlines announced it has bought a new "Falcon" plane to join its already existed four planes. The company's director general A'ed Qintar said that buying this new plane comes in the framework of the company's care to cope with the increasing demands for its flights, mostly used by business men.
